2.6 Additio nal Devices

This section describes the types and features of devices that can be connected optionally
when OfficeServ 7030 is installed.
2.6.1 On Ho ld/Backg ro und So und So urce
OfficeServ 7030 is connected with cassettes or radios in addition to the basic tone provided
by the system or internal sound source to allow subscribers to listen to melodies other than
ones specified to the subscribers. The devices such as the cassettes or radios are called on
hold/background sound source.
The on hold/background sound source is mainly used for on hold tone, background music,
or announcement and can be used by being connected with the external sound source
devices below:
FM radio

CD player

Cassette tape recorder

Output Resistance
The speaker output resistance of FM radios, CD players, or cassette recorders is
normally 8 W or 16 W.
2.6.2 External Bro adcasting Units
OfficeServ 7030 is connected with external broadcasting units such as amplifiers or
speakers for consumers instead of internal speakers. These external broadcasting units are
embedded in the control board, and are connected via the MISC ports.
2.6.3 Lo ud Bell
The Loud Bell allows the users to listen to ring signals from outside, and amplifiers or
external speakers are used for the Loud Bell.
The Loud Bell is connected via the MISC port of Base board. Once the secondary call
device is connected, a call signal rings from only a specific phone set to MMC 205 Assign
Pair Station of Loud Bell.
2.6.4 Co mmo n Bell
The Common Bell is a ring that can be specified when a station group is set. Once a station
in a group rings, other stations in the group ring. The Common Bell is connected via the
MISC port of Base board
